Intake Manifold

Has any one used the Edelbrock performer intake for the 351w ? I know that leaking is sometimes a problem but I'm beginning to think there may be fit problems too.I'm using the non EGA model # 2181. I've got white exhaust on the right bank, and I guess this is water entering the combustion chamber. No visible leaks though. And i'm not going through water like I was after the first install. 3rd times a charm.
I used a fel-pro gasket non valley type, with ultra grey rtv on the ends. Torqued to 25 ft lbs several times through. Can the manifold draw up on the heads?, I've heard that heads bolts are sometimes torqued an extra 10 ft lbs to offset this effect. could I have caused a head problem. The problem is more pronounced during acceleration. +

Intake Manifold

i have had a leak problem before and found that a re-torque of the upper row only helped. torque the head bolts after you are satisfied that the intake is torqued to spec. remember that more is not better when it comes to over tightening the intake. good luck
